How much do english instructor j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 17, 2026, the average hourly pay for english instructor in Atlanta, GA is $24.87,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.63 and $27.74 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an English instructor?

To thrive as an English Instructor, you need a strong grasp of English grammar, literature, and composition, typically supported by a bachelor's or master's degree in English or education. Familiarity with learning management systems (LMS), digital teaching tools, and standardized testing platforms is essential. Exceptional communication, adaptability, and cultural sensitivity help foster effective learning and student engagement. These skills and qualities are crucial for delivering impactful instruction and supporting diverse student needs in various educational settings.

What are some common challenges English instructors face when teaching students with varying proficiency levels in the same class?

English Instructors often work with students whose language abilities range from beginner to advanced within the same classroom. This can make lesson planning and classroom management more complex, as instructors must create activities that engage and support all learners. Differentiating instruction, providing tailored feedback, and balancing the pace of the curriculum are key strategies used to address these challenges. Collaborating with fellow instructors and utilizing adaptive learning resources can also help ensure each student makes meaningful progress.
